If you are going to major in Accounting, you will unfortunately have to take this class. My poor rating is both for the class and the professor. Dr. Magner is the only professor who currently teaches ACCT 310.

Your grade is determined as follows:
There are six 16 point quizzes that pertain to a topic you recently learned. He will drop the lowest grade.

There is a project worth 30 points. This is not a group project. You will turn in a paper and the disk. Be sure to read the directions very carefully. This project not only wants you to know how to do the problem, but also how to correctly format an accounting spreadsheet.

There are three exams worth 100 points each. These exams are a comination of MC and problems. These tests are very difficult. I would suggest that you practice the homework problems and attempt to do the suggested practice problems. It took most students the entire class time to take the exams.

The final is cumulative MC, and again very difficult. It is worth 150 points. It is impossible to have an A before taking the final, thus it is mandatory.

Dr. Magner is very intelligent and thoroughly knows Cost Accounting. However, he is not a good teacher. I (and others that I have spoken with) do not understand how we could do so well in ACCT 201 and not replicate those same grades in ACCT 310, given the fact that the material is essentially the same. Dr. Magner believes that students memorize formulas and layouts in ACCT 201 and seems to design his tests and quizzes so that you cannot memorize the material.

Dr. Magner has little patience for tardiness and students who don't pay attention. He will call you out if you are sleeping or doing something rather than Cost Accounting. Class begins promptly and you will stay the entire class period (and then some).

Though ACCT 300 is supposedly the "weed-out" class, I know of many more people who have changed their major because of ACCT 310. I would not suggest that you take these two classes simultaneously. In order to do well in 310, you need to devote some time to the class.
